Being raised on social media + lockdowns during a crucial stage of establishing one’s social identity really has left many zoomers extremely stunted socially. They appear aloof and uncaring because they don’t know how to communicate, so they just look disinterested. Many zoomers have social anxiety, so they may hesitate to pick up the phone to ask a question. This stems from how absurd schools have gotten about punishing students for being curious, reading ahead, showing initiative, brainstorming alternative solutions, or asking questions. They’ve basically been indoctrinated to follow orders and ONLY follow orders, and if there’s any grey area, do nothing and await further instruction. This is stupid, but blame our moronic schools.
In a new job, without adequate training and goal-setting by management, it can be difficult for employees to know what is expected of them. You don’t know what you don’t know, and you can’t ask if you’re not even aware of the issue.
My recommendation is more communication, less assumptions, and being incredibly direct about what you want and what is and isn’t acceptable.
